﻿/* THREE COLUMN LIQUID CENTER LAYOUT */

	


	
		
	

		
#threecolwrap{
	margin:auto;
	margin:-190px 0 0 80px;
  	width:891px;
	background:url("images/contentbg.png") no-repeat;
 	}	
	
#header {
	margin:auto;
	width:1051px;
	height:375px;
	background:url(images/constructionhomeheaderbg.jpg) no-repeat;
	}
	
#subheader img{
	width:305px;
	float:left;
		}
		
#partnerlogos {
 	width:100%;
 	text-align:center;
 				}
			
#partnerlogos img{
 	
 	 	vertical-align:middle;
 	 	padding:0 5px 0 0;
			}

.const_prod_prologvid_image {
	
	position:relative;
	float:right;
	margin-right:90px;
	}

		
#formthankyou_header {
	position:relative;
	float:left;
	width:450px;
	height:auto;
	margin:50px 0 10px 0px;
	}

		
#formthankyou_header p {
font-size:1.3em;
color:#607cc8;
font-weight:bold;
text-align:center;
margin:14px 0 0 0;

}	

#ctl00_PlaceHolderLeftNavBar_idNavLinkViewAll
{
visibility:hidden;
display:none;
} /*hides "view all site content" link on the bottom*/

	
.clearfix:after {
content: ".";
display: block;
height: 0; 
clear: both;
visibility: hidden;
}
.clearfix {display: inline-table;}
*html .clearfix {height: 1%;}
.clearfix {display: block;}



